I am still missing my husband desperately. We are getting the divorce and I'm to the point where I am numb. I don't cry as much, but I'm still very sad.

I have actually been on a few dates over the past week and met a very nice guy who seems to really like me just as much as I like him. We chat a couple times a day and he is very sweet, but I always end up going right back to thinking about my husband.

I spoke to him yesterday and he sounded so depressed. I wanted to tell him to come to me, but I knew it would be a waste of my breath. I still can't believe this is happening.

This is always a hard time to go through. I'm sorry for your loss....that's exactly what it is isn't it, a loss in your life?? No matter how things were in your marriage, when it's disolved, it is a loss. I do so hope it gets easier for you soon. Remember to take care of you and allow those feelings of loss to play out. Time does heal wounds and makes things easier down the road.
